General Info
In Block
667fc035e426ee79bc249676ff40dfcc02743bc4f6dd629b0c434b2f63852fac
In block height
Total Input
2491637.14393891 RDD
Total Output
2493435.58055634 RDD
Transaction Details
Fee
0 RDD
mined Wed, 04 Mar 2015 00:59:10 UTC
From
1245134.73 RDDFrom
1246502.41393891 RDD